Term 3: cos(yt)
No units are specified for cos(yt) in the equation, which implies that the input must be dimensionless. Therefore, the product yt also needs to be dimensionless.

To achieve dimensionless units for yt, we need to ensure that the units of y and t cancel each other out. Given that the units of t are s/K and the units of yt should be dimensionless, the units of y must be K/s.
